Stability analysis of jointed rock slope based on strength reduction method
To analyze the stability of the mining area,the stope slope partition was carried out according to the engineering geological conditions,slope geometry and slope surface inclination.The results show that the jointed rock slope profile in the northern area is in the ultimate equilibrium state,and the occurrence state and slope height of the weathered rock layer have a great impact on the safety of the slope,so it is necessary to pay attention to the weathered rock layer and the local broken rock mass,and the plastic strain zone is mainly concentrated in the top weathered monzogranite layer,which is relatively concentrated,resulting in local failure of the slope.The overall stability of the section in the northeast area is higher than that in the north area,and the plastic strain zone is mainly concentrated in the 3-2-1 fragmented structure monzogranite layer and the 3-2-2 block structure monzogranite layer,and the continuous plastic slip zone is penetrated,resulting in the overall failure of the slope.
